MDEV-33799: mysql_manager_submit Segfault at Startup Still Possible During Recovery
MDEV-26473 fixed a segmentation fault at startup between the handle manager thread and the binlog background thread, such that the binlog background thread could be started and submit a job to the handle manager, before it had initialized. Where MDEV-26473 made it so the handle manager would initialize before the main thread started the normal binary logs, it did not account for the recovery case. That is, there is still a possibility of a segmentation fault when a server is recovering using the binary logs such that it can open the binary logs, start the binlog background thread, and submit a job to the handle manager before it is initialized. This patch fixes this by moving the initialization of the mysql handler manager to happen prior to recovery. Reviewed By: ============ Andrei Elkin <andrei.elkin@mariadb.com>
